US Secretary of State Blinken Urges Israel to Address Rising Civilian Death Toll in Gaza Offensive

US Secretary of State Antony Blinken has arrived in Israel, aiming to press the Israeli government on its offensive in Gaza, which has resulted in a growing civilian death toll and garnered international condemnation. This visit marks Blinken’s third trip to Israel in recent weeks, highlighting the urgency of the situation. He will meet with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u and other senior officials to discuss the need for Israel to balance its defense efforts with the protection of civilians.

Blinken’s arrival in Tel Aviv on Friday morning was accompanied by newly appointed US Ambassador to Israel Jack Lew. Before departing from Washington, DC, Blinken stated that he plans to engage in discussions with the Israeli government about the ongoing campaign against the Hamas terrorist organization. He emphasized the importance of taking necessary steps to protect civilians in the conflict-ridden region.

While Blinken did not provide specific details about the concrete steps to better safeguard civilians, he condemned Hamas for using civilians as human shields and embedding its fighters within civilian infrastructure. He reiterated the US government’s commitment to responding to the tragic loss of innocent lives, emphasizing the equal importance of safeguarding both Palestinian and Israeli children.

Internally, US officials have privately warned their Israeli counterparts about the impact of graphic images depicting the devastation and suffering in Gaza. They have stressed the significance of allowing humanitarian aid and avoiding worsening diplomatic ramifications as international condemnation escalates. Arab partners, including Jordan and Bahrain, have already recalled their ambassadors in response to Israel’s campaign in Gaza.

During his visit, Blinken will also focus on ensuring the continued flow of humanitarian aid and facilitating the departure of civilians from Gaza. Departures of civilians began on Wednesday through the Rafah Gate to Egypt and are expected to continue in the coming days. Blinken emphasized the arduous and high-level efforts required to reach this point, involving significant US pressure on all involved parties.
